O. P. Bobrov S. N. Laptev H. Neuhäuser V. A. Khonik K. Csach 《Physics of the Solid State》2004,46(10):1863-1867
Isochronous relaxation of tensile stresses is measured in a bulk Pd40Cu30Ni10P20 metallic glass in the initial state and after certain thermal treatments. The results of measurements are used to find the energy spectrum of irreversible structural relaxation, from which the temperature dependence of shear viscosity is then calculated. This dependence is also found independently from measurements of creep in the same glass. The calculated viscosity is shown to agree well with the experimental data. 相似文献

Vedernikov Johan Lugtenburg Andrey A. Khodonov 《Journal of inclusion phenomena and macrocyclic chemistry》2004,49(1-2):153-161
An effective synthetic approach to the preparation of a new crown-ether vinylogs involving the Horner–Emmons olefination of carbonyl precursors with the use of C2- and C5-phosphonates was proposed. The effects of the conjugation chain length and the nature of the terminal polar functions in the phosphonate reagent on the yield and process stereoselectivity were discussed. 相似文献

Mathematical model of gas treatment to remove a finely dispersed phase, based on the theory of turbulent migration of particles, is discussed. In the approach used, the aerosol separation is considered as a kind of a diffusion process using equations of the mass transfer theory. Expressions are presented for calculating the gas cleaning efficiency in tubular, vortex, and packed gas separators. A specific feature of these expressions is that the calculations can be performed using the hydraulic resistance of the working zone of the apparatus. 相似文献

Konstantin P. Arefyev Victor I. Grafutin Evgeny P. Prokopyev Andrey M. Lider Roman S. Laptev Yury S. Bordulev 《Central European Journal of Chemistry》2014,12(12):1280-1284
This article considers the possibility of applying the positron annihilation spectroscopy method for investigating the pore space of rocks from oil-gas and methane-coal deposits. The diagnostics of the structure was performed using the method of spectrometry of angular correlation of annihilation rays (ACAR). Using the samples of porous silicon, the authors have shown the applicability of the ACAR method for determination of the average dimensions of spherical and cylindrical nanosized objects and their concentration 相似文献

Yushchenko 《Physics of Atomic Nuclei》2007,70(4):702-708
Results of study of the $K^ - \to \pi ^0 e^ - \overline \nu \gamma $ decay at the ISTRA+ setup are presented. We observed 4476 events of this decay. The branching ratio is found to be $R = \frac{{Br(K^ - \to \pi ^0 e^ - \overline \nu _e \gamma )}}{{Br(K^ - \to \pi ^0 e^ - \overline \nu _e )}}$ = (1.81±0.03(stat.)±0.07(syst.)) × 10?2 for E*γ > 10 MeV and θ*eγ > 10°. For comparison with the previous experiment the branching ratio with cuts E*γ > 10 MeV, 0.6 < cos θ*eγ < 0.9 is calculated: R = $\frac{{Br(K^ - \to \pi ^0 e^ - \overline \nu _e \gamma )}}{{Br(K^ - \to \pi ^0 e^ - \overline \nu _e )}}$ = (0.47±0.02(stat.) ± 0.03(syst.)) × 10?2. For the cuts E*γ > 30 MeV and θ*eγ > 20°, used in most theoretical papers, Br = (3.06 ± 0.09(stat.) ± 0.14(syst.)) × 10?4. For the asymmetry we get A ξ = ?0.015 ± 0.021. At present it is the best estimate of this asymmetry. 相似文献
